Daniel Gaudet, M.S.M.
Déline, Northwest Territories
Danny Gaudet negotiated the Déline Final Self-Government Agreement Act, the first of its kind in Canada. The model has provided the remote Indigenous community with independence, while empowering it to tackle alcoholism, violence and economic development. His efforts in leading the establishment of the government’s constitution, electoral processes and financial administration stand as a shining example for other communities to follow on their path towards greater self-determination.
